1. 研究目的与意义
随着智能手机的快速普及,智能手机操作系统市场风生水起。为了让智能手机用户能够随时随地查询互联网所提供的服务,一种高效的办法就是将应用系统的功能拓展到手机终端上,让手机能够通过移动网以及互联网访问Web网站并处理各种各样的业务。因此,智能手机的应用软件及其需要的服务将有广阔的发展前景。Android的最大特点是其开放性体系架构,不仅具有非常好的开发、调试环境,而且还支持各种可扩展的用户体验,包括丰富的图形组件、多媒体支持功能以及强大的浏览器。
基于以上原因,我选择了#8220;基于Android平台的智能考勤与平时成绩管理系统的开发#8221;为毕业设计题目。由于自己数据库知识掌握较好,所以选择了该系统为自己的毕业设计工作。
2. 研究内容和预期目标
研究内容:学生信息管理:包括学生注册(包括手机号码、地址等基本信息)录入、修改和删除,学生登录功能;考勤签到管理:实现学生以登录的方式实现自动点名,教师可以在线查看;课堂表现管理:教师根据学生回答问题的情况以及课堂表现记录所得分值;作业管理:教师可以发布作业并根据学生作业完成情况记录所得分值;教师管理:平时成绩=考勤 课堂表现 作业,系统能根据考勤和课堂回答问题的记录以及作业情况,按指定的比例生成平时成绩表;课程管理:管理员发布课程,学生可以在线查看;系统后台管理功能:管理员可以进行后台数据维护等功能。
系统中解决的关键问题如下:
第一,如何保证多用户同时在线操作而保持数据的准确性;
3. 国内外研究现状
Android是一种基于Linux的自由及开放源代码的操作系统,主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发。尚未有统一中文名称,中国大陆地区较多人使用#8220;安卓#8221;或#8220;安致#8221;。Android操作系统最初由Andy Rubin开发,主要支持手机。2005年8月由Google收购注资。2007年11月,Google与84家硬件制造商、软件开发商及电信营运商组建开放手机联盟共同研发改良Android系统。随后Google以Apache开源许可证的授权方式,发布了Android的源代码。第一部Android智能手机发布于2008年10月。Android逐渐扩展到平板电脑及其他领域上,如电视、数码相机、游戏机等。2011年第一季度,Android在全球的市场份额首次超过塞班系统,跃居全球第一。 2012年11月数据显示,Android占据全球智能手机操作系统市场76%的份额,中国市场占有率为90%。2013年09月24日谷歌开发的操作系统Android在迎来了5岁生日,全世界采用这款系统的设备数量已经达到10亿台。此次开发的系统只是一个能耗数据管理的小系统,功能虽不强大,但意义重大。
4. 计划与进度安排
系统的设计方案:17年9月份,开始查阅相关资料,为功能的实现打好理论基础。17年10月份,完成数据库的构建,包括创建系统所需的各张表和存储过程。17年11月份进入系统功能实现阶段,本人的系统所需实现的开发环境:Android的上层应用程序是用Java语言开发,同时还需要基于Dalvik虚拟机,所以,Google公司推荐使用主流的Java继承开发环境Eclipse。只有Eclipse还不够,因为是使用Java语言进行开发,还应该有由SUN公司提供的Java SDK(其中包括JRE:JavaRuntime Environment)。此外,Android的应用程序开发和Java开发有较大区别的,所以还需要有Google提供的Android SDK。同时,还需要在Eclipse安装ADT,为Android开发提供开发工具的升级或者变更,是Eclipse下开发工具的升级下载的工具。17年12月份完成系统功能的实现,对系统进行测试。18年1月份整合系统功能,完成毕业设计的所有工作。
论文的撰写方案:本人计划于18年3月初开始查阅相关论文撰写资料,3月中旬定论文提纲,4月份完成论文的撰写工作,5月底定论文终稿,6月份答辩。
5. 参考文献
[1] http://developer.android. com
[2]Google Buys Android for Its MobileArsenal.Businessweek.com.2005.08
[3]Lynnette Luna. Android now dominatesmobile OS market and it may lean in malware too.fiercemobileit.com. 2011.03
以上是毕业论文开题报告,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。